The Peacemaking Program was developed to revive traditional Navajo justice methods. Beginning in the late 1800s, federal authorities instituted a Court of Indian Offenses on the Navajo Nation. WebThe modern Navajo Nation Code allows disputes over leases and permits to be resolved in the Navajo Nation courts, and the BIA is required, in acknowledgement of limited tribal sovereignty, to implement the court decisions.
